Questions & Answers

What companies run services between Nice, France and Winterthur, Switzerland?

Swiss and Lufthansa fly from Nice Côte D'Azur International Airport (NCE) to Zurich Airport (ZRH) 5 times a day. Alternatively, BlaBlaCar Bus operates a bus from Nice - Airport Bus Station Terminal 1 to Zürich once daily. Tickets cost CHF 26–45 and the journey takes 8h 40m.
